Q: Is 2,665,075 a Prime Number?
A: No, 2,665,075 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 2665075 can be evenly divided by 1 5 7 25 35 97 157 175 485 679 785 1,099 2,425 3,395 3,925 5,495 15,229 16,975 27,475 76,145 106,603 380,725 533,015 and 2,665,075, with no remainder.
Since 2,665,075 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,665,075, it is not a prime number.
